Understanding Passport Photo Background Requirements

One of the most common questions about passport and visa photos is: **"What color should my background be?"** The answer depends on which country's document you're applying for.

Getting the background color wrong is a **top reason for photo rejection**. This guide covers the exact requirements for every major country, so you can get it right the first time.

Quick Answer: Most Common Requirements

| Country | Background Color | Notes | |---------|-----------------|-------| | **United States** | White or off-white | No patterns, no shadows | | **United Kingdom** | Plain light grey or cream | NOT pure white | | **Canada** | White | Must be uniform | | **Australia** | Plain white | No shadows | | **European Union (Schengen)** | Light grey (preferred) or white | Varies by country | | **India** | White | For passports and most visas | | **China** | White | Strict requirements | | **Japan** | White | No colored backgrounds | | **South Korea** | White | Uniform white only | | **Singapore** | White | No off-white |

US Passport & Visa Photo Background

Official Requirements:

The US State Department requires:

  • **Plain white or off-white background**
  • **No patterns, textures, or shadows**
  • **Uniform color across entire background**
  • **No visible objects behind the subject**
  • What "Off-White" Means:

    The State Department accepts backgrounds that appear white in the photo, even if they have a very slight cream or grey tint. However, the background should **not** be:

  • ❌ Yellow or warm-tinted
  • ❌ Blue or any other color
  • ❌ Grey (too dark)
  • ❌ Patterned or textured

    UK Passport Photo Background

    The UK is Different!

    Unlike most countries, the UK specifically does **NOT** want pure white backgrounds:

  • **Plain light grey** (preferred)
  • **Cream colored** (acceptable)
  • ❌ **Pure white** (may be rejected)
  • ❌ **Patterned or textured**
  • Why UK Avoids White:

    UK passports use white paper, and a pure white background can make it difficult to see the edge of the photo. Light grey provides contrast.

    Acceptable UK Background Colors:

    | Color | Acceptable? | |-------|-------------| | Light grey | Preferred | | Cream | Yes | | Off-white | Yes | | Pure white | ⚠️ May be rejected | | Blue | ❌ No | | Other colors | ❌ No |

    European Union (Schengen) Countries

    General EU/Schengen Requirements:

    Most EU countries follow ICAO (International Civil Aviation Organization) standards:

  • **Light colored background** (white, light grey, or light blue)
  • **Uniform with no shadows**
  • **No patterns**
  • Country-Specific Variations:

    | Country | Preferred Background | |---------|---------------------| | **Germany** | Light grey | | **France** | Light grey or light blue | | **Italy** | White | | **Spain** | White | | **Netherlands** | Light grey | | **Belgium** | White or light grey | | **Switzerland** | Light grey | | **Austria** | Light grey | | **Portugal** | White | | **Greece** | White |

    Safe Choice for Schengen Visas:

    Use **light grey** — it's accepted by all Schengen countries and won't cause rejection.

  • Common Background Color Mistakes

    ❌ Mistake 1: Using a Colored Wall

    Many people take photos against a beige, yellow, or light blue wall thinking it's "close enough."

    Solution: Use a pure white backdrop or AI background removal.

    ❌ Mistake 2: Shadows on Background

    Even with the right color, shadows can cause rejection.

    Solution: Stand 2-3 feet away from the wall and use front-facing light.

    ❌ Mistake 3: Uneven Background Color

    Lighting differences can make one side lighter than the other.

    Solution: Use diffused lighting from multiple angles or AI correction.

    ❌ Mistake 4: Visible Texture

    Textured walls, wallpaper patterns, or wrinkled fabric backdrops.

    Solution: Use smooth white poster board or AI background replacement.

    ❌ Mistake 5: Wrong Color for the Country

    Using white for a UK photo, or blue for a US photo.

    Solution: Always check the specific country requirements before taking photos.

    How to Get the Right Background at Home

    DIY Background Options:

  • 1. **White poster board** (~$1 at Dollar Tree)
  • - Clean, smooth surface - Easy to position - Portable

  • 2. **White bed sheet** (free if you have one)
  • - Hang flat against a wall - Iron out wrinkles - Avoid textured fabrics

  • 3. **White wall** (if you have one)
  • - Must be smooth (no texture) - Evenly lit - No marks or scuffs

  • 4. **Photography backdrop paper** (~$15-25)
  • - Professional results - Pure white - Reusable

  • Background Requirements by Document Type

    US Documents:

    | Document | Background | |----------|------------| | US Passport | White | | US Visa (DS-160) | White | | Green Card (I-485) | White | | EAD (I-765) | White | | Travel Document (I-131) | White | | REAL ID | Varies by state |

    International Documents:

    | Document | Background | |----------|------------| | Schengen Visa | Light grey/white | | UK Passport | Light grey/cream | | Canadian Passport | White | | Australian Passport | White | | Chinese Visa | White | | Indian Passport | White |

    FAQ: Background Color Questions

    Can I use a grey background for US photos?

    No. US passport and visa photos require white or off-white backgrounds. Grey will likely cause rejection.
